What are delivery jobs?

Delivery jobs involve transporting goods, packages, or food from a business or depot to customers at their homes or workplaces. Delivery workers can operate various vehicles, including bikes, cars, vans, or trucks, depending on the type and size of the items being delivered. These roles often require good customer service skills, reliability, and the ability to navigate routes efficiently. Delivery jobs are available in many industries, such as retail, food service, and logistics, and may offer flexible hours or shifts.

What are some common challenges faced by delivery drivers and how can they be managed effectively?

Delivery drivers often encounter challenges such as navigating traffic congestion, meeting tight delivery schedules, and ensuring the safe handling of packages. To manage these effectively, drivers typically rely on route optimization tools, maintain clear communication with dispatchers, and practice good time management skills. Staying organized and prepared for unexpected situations, such as weather delays or customer address issues, also helps improve efficiency and job satisfaction.

How much does Amazon Flex really pay?

Amazon Flex delivery drivers typically earn between $18 and $25 per hour, depending on location, time of day, and delivery volume. Drivers are paid per delivery block, and earnings can vary based on factors such as tips and efficiency, with some drivers earning more during peak hours or busy periods.

What Is a Delivery Job?

A delivery job is one in which you deliver goods to warehouse facilities, shipping companies, retailers, or customers. Examples of delivery jobs include delivery driver and courier. As a delivery driver, you operate a large van or truck to carry products and packages between locations, sometimes over long distances. As a courier, you deliver documents and small parcels between parties, usually within a city. Working as a courier, you may drive a car or make your deliveries by motorcycle or bicycle.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Delivery Driver,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Delivery Driver, you need a valid driver's license, a good driving record, and knowledge of local routes and traffic laws. Familiarity with GPS navigation systems, route optimization apps, and sometimes handheld scanners is typically required. Reliability, time management, and strong customer service skills help you stand out in this role. These skills ensure timely, accurate deliveries and a positive experience for customers, which is essential for success in the position.

What is the difference between Delivery vs Courier?

AspectDeliveryCourier
CredentialsMay require a valid driver’s license, sometimes specialized certifications for certain goodsTypically requires a valid driver’s license; certifications are uncommon
Work EnvironmentVaries from trucks, vans, to bikes; often involves long hours and route planningPrimarily on foot, bike, or vehicle; focused on quick, local deliveries
Industry UsageUsed across retail, food, logistics, and e-commerce sectorsCommonly associated with express shipping, food delivery, and small parcel services

Delivery and courier roles both involve transporting goods, but delivery often covers larger or varied items over longer distances, while couriers typically focus on quick, local deliveries of smaller packages or documents. Understanding these differences helps job seekers find the right role based on their skills and preferences.

Job description

The Copier Delivery Specialist is responsible for performing copier deliveries and installations within assigned territories to clients.
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S:

  • Review daily delivery schedule, confirm scheduling calls have been made in advance to client, distribution centers and/or office.
  • Deliver equipment to specified locations ensuring all established quality assurance standards are met.
  • Assist with product set-ups and installations as necessary.
  • Pick up appropriate copier equipment and supplies to return ensuring all paperwork is present and completely filled out and turned in to the proper personnel.
  • Obtain client signatures on required paperwork and turn in to designated representatives in a timely manner.
  • Train and remain up to date on install requirements as copier make and models change.
  • Conduct weekly maintenance and cleaning of area.
  • Accurately maintain and comply with documentation and service administrative procedures in a timely basis to include time entry process.
  • Attend required company and departmental meetings.

QUALIFICATIONS:

  • High school diploma and two years of delivery experience; or equivalent combination of education and experience.
  • Significant mechanical or electronics background/experience preferred.
  • Valid Driver's License, proof of personal insurance, and an acceptable driving record.
